Current Echo Device Line-Up Comparison
The Echo Dot is the smaller, though still feature-packed, sibling of the main Echo line of devices. The first three Echo Dots use a hockey puck disk design, while the fourth-generation model has a spherical look. Additional Echo Dot with Clock and Echo Dot Kids Edition versions of the third and fourth generation models are also available with the same hardware as the base models but with a visible digital clock on the former and additional safety features and cute colorful designs on the latter.
The numbers in the Echo Show 5 and 8 names refer to the screens’ size, 5- and 8-inch respectively, even though both are second-generation models. Similarly, the number in the Echo Show 10’s title refers to its 10-inch screen, not the model generation, which is the third.

The Echo Look was a precursor to Echo Show and was an intelligent selfie camera. All Echo Look devices were remotely disabled in mid-2020 so, even if you manage to buy one, it won’t function.
